Introduction

Shorthanded (6-max) hold'em can be a diverse animal than ten or nine handed poker. Lower limit shorthanded poker has a couple of more wrinkles than the increased limit variety. A great deal of the literature regarding shorthanded poker is aimed at the higher limits, where quite a few post-flop battles are heads up. We will focus on games similar to the one/two 6 max games at Party Poker

Beginning Hands

As at any degree of poker, beginning hands are the foundation of the holdem game. On the one/two six max tables, you'll frequently be facing a couple of or three opponents with VPIP's (voluntarily put $ in the pot...see Poker Tracker Guide for far more detail) of fifty percent or more. Now, just because quite a few of the opponents are going to be commencing with shaky hands doesn't mean you need to stoop to their level. Texas hold'em at any level is about playing commencing hands with optimistic anticipated values. The other poker players' looseness combined with the fewer amount of opponents will make it possible for you to bet on more hands, except it can be nevertheless optimal to keep your VPIP below 30.

In general, playing six max, raise with any Ace with a kicker of 10 or bigger, King-Queen and King-Jack, and Queen-Jack suited as well as pairs down to nines. You should limp with any two cards 10 or greater in any position. In the last two seats, you are able to play any two cards nine or higher. Suited connectors down to sixty five can be wagered anywhere and any other hand with two suited cards 8 or larger as nicely as suited Aces may be played. Pocket 6's and 7's are playable anywhere. Using the smaller pockets, bet on them if you will discover 2 limpers ahead of you. The hands you decide to wager on in the 1st 2 seats may be extended to a few of the suited connectors or lower pairs if you are wagering at an exceptionally passive table with little raising.

Steal Raises

Most of the hands we advised you to wager on need to be opened for a increase in those rare cases when you happen to be for the button in a pot that hasn't been entered. Beware...stealing the blinds is incredibly challenging in reduced control shorthanded texas holdem. Most poker players betting this level will call your increase with virtually anything in the huge blind. Numerous will call from the smaller blind. Steal raises from the cutoff seat are generally not advisable. You may perhaps stretch your raising requirements SLIGHTLY if earliest in soon after 2 have folded, except don't forget you've nevertheless got 60 percent of your opponents yet to act. Increase when you can expect to narrow the field to one, for then you'll be in the driver's seat.

Aggression

Shorthanded (6-max) holdem is generally characterized by aggression. This is true in the reduced restrict shorthanded 6 max games as very well, even so, the unbridled aggression efficient at larger limits may perhaps not serve you as effectively in minimal restrict poker. You must remain aggressive, but beware that the conditions are various and you may perhaps not be in a position to bully your way to as several pots. Commonly, your preflop raises is going to be met by 2 or a lot more callers. When you improve with two superior cards and miss the flop, you might be probably behind in the hand. With two opponents, we advocate betting the flop. One luxury of low restriction poker is that your bets will not often be met with raises or check-raises.

The six-max tables are filled with calling stations...your greatest hands will receive callers, except in the event you boost with KQ and there is an ace and two rags around the flop, you can not be capable to bet your opponent's pocket twos off the hand most of the time. Similarly, hands like pocket sevens which are fine raising hands shorthanded in larger restriction poker are not profitable when raised at lower limits. With multiple callers anticipated, you'll likely need to hit a set to win...so raising increases your investment and is often a inadequate bet on from an expected value standpoint.

HitTheFlop

If you've hit your flop, then you must be particularly aggressive. Slow wagering is commonly a no-no (unless you might have a set or are heads up, then you can find times when a slow bet on is called for). Bear in mind, most of these low-limit hold em players will call you down with hands like middle or bottom pair, a gutshot or even an overcard or 2. Do not allow them to poor beat you cheaply. Generate them pay to see their longshot draws. Extract your money from them when you've got the edge. Remember also that in shorthanded poker games best pair with mediocre kicker is usually a much greater hand than it really is on full tables. If I flop leading pair with my King-Twos in the tiny blind, i am usually going to check raise. Check-raising out of the blinds is incredibly profitable.

Late players will bet their gutshots or bottom pairs, and, additional importantly, will pay you off to the river right after your check-raise. This is an essential play...not only will it earn you money when it works except it will discourage gamblers from trying to steal pots. Check-raises with just leading pair are very rare at small constrain holdem, and your opponents will generate note of it and fear you. Any flop in which you've got prime pair should be raised, unless there was a preflop raiser. Then, use your judgement as to no matter whether he ought to be checkraised, depending on the board and his raising frequency.
